#1926 add getJvmThumbnailOptionsAsArray

This commit is contained in:
Shinsuke Sugaya 2018-12-04 06:38:05 +09:00
parent 38eaea0b2d
commit ee3f5af858
2 changed files with 8 additions and 2 deletions

View file

@ -172,8 +172,8 @@ public class GenerateThumbnailJob extends ExecJob {
if (logLevel != null) {
cmdList.add("-Dfess.log.level=" + logLevel);
}
stream(fessConfig.getJvmThumbnailOptions())
.of(stream -> stream.filter(StringUtil::isNotBlank).forEach(value -> cmdList.add(value)));
stream(fessConfig.getJvmThumbnailOptionsAsArray()).of(
stream -> stream.filter(StringUtil::isNotBlank).forEach(value -> cmdList.add(value)));
File ownTmpDir = null;
final String tmpDir = System.getProperty("java.io.tmpdir");

View file

@ -681,6 +681,12 @@ public interface FessProp {
return getJvmSuggestOptions().split("\n");
}
String getJvmThumbnailOptions();
default String[] getJvmThumbnailOptionsAsArray() {
return getJvmThumbnailOptions().split("\n");
}
String getCrawlerDocumentHtmlPrunedTags();
default PrunedTag[] getCrawlerDocumentHtmlPrunedTagsAsArray() {